Subject: [PATCH 1/4] ftrace/x86: Make sure to modify 5-bite instructions
Date: Mon, 27 Jun 2016 15:54:34 +0200	[thread overview]
Message-ID: <1467035677-12193-2-git-send-email-pmladek@suse.com> (raw)
In-Reply-To: <1467035677-12193-1-git-send-email-pmladek@suse.com>

The commit 8329e818f14926a604 ("ftrace/x86: Set ftrace_stub to weak to
prevent gcc from using short jumps to it") fixed a situation where we
replaced 2-byte with 5-byte jump instruction.

The original problem crashed the kernel with

  # cd /sys/kernel/trace
  # echo function_graph > current_tracer
  # echo nop > current_tracer

We already avoid similar crashes by paranoid checks, for example
in add_break() or ftrace_modify_code_direct(). These checks did
not help in the above situation because the old expected code
was read from the location that was modified. See the memcpy()
in update_ftrace_func().

Normally, the expected code is generated according to the expected
state of the modified location. update_ftrace_func() is called
in several situations. It is not easy to generate the expected code
a reasonable way. But the function seems to be called only when
we modify a call or a jump instruction. We could at least check
that it is the 5-byte variant.

@@ -235,6 +235,15 @@ static int update_ftrace_func(unsigned long ip, void *new)
 
 	memcpy(old, (void *)ip, MCOUNT_INSN_SIZE);
 
+	/*
+	 * Make sure that we replace 5-byte instruction that
+	 * is either a call or a jump.
+	 */
+	if (old[0] != 0xe8 && old[0] != 0xe9) {
+		pr_warn("Expected e8 or e9, got %x\n", old[0]);
+		return -EINVAL;
+	}
+
 	ftrace_update_func = ip;
 	/* Make sure the breakpoints see the ftrace_update_func update */
 	smp_wmb();
